GOOGLE ADS

miércoles, 13 de abril de 2022

¿Es <a href="example.com/page.php#page" rel="noindex, nofollow"> correcto?

En mi sitio tengo la página http://www.example.com/page.php, sin embargo, tengo enlaces que conducen a http://www.example.com/page.php#page, así que no quiero que sean indexado o seguido. ¿Será correcto marcar estos enlaces como

<a href="http://www.example.com/page.php#page" rel="noindex, nofollow"> 

Además, como metaetiqueta canónica en la misma página que ya tengo

<link rel="canonical" href="http://www.example.com/page.php" /> 

¡¡¡Gracias!!!

PD: pregunto si esta sintaxis es correcta, no cómo funciona Google y cuál es su política hacia las URL


Solución del problema

Tiene una sintaxis no válida en el atributo "rel". Debe contener una lista de palabras clave separadas por espacios en blanco; elimine la coma.

La palabra clave "nofollow" es correcta. La palabra clave "noindex" no tiene sentido.

Editar: Aclaración a pedido.

La sintaxis adecuada sería

<a href="http://www.example.com/page.php#page" rel="noindex nofollow">

Pero tener "noindex" en el enlace no tiene sentido porque esta palabra clave obviamente pertenece a la página enlazada, por lo que debe definirse allí para toda la página (en la metaetiqueta de la página de destino o robots.txt). Puede haber muchos enlaces que apuntan a esa página y SE no sabría qué enlace es correcto para reclamar "noindex" en la página de destino...

No hay comentarios.:

Publicar un comentario

Flutter: error de rango al acceder a la respuesta JSON

Estoy accediendo a una respuesta JSON con la siguiente estructura. { "fullName": "FirstName LastName", "listings...